Abstract
At the end of this course, students can distinguish paradigmatic (lexical synonyms, opposites etc.) and syntagmatic relationships in the word stock. They can form relevant word and stet them into proper context. They know the most common lexical divergences between Czech and German and develop their vocabulary
Key topics
Fields of lexikology word-stock of a language, its elements and criteria of its division lexical clusteringschanges in word-stock regional differences in German word-stock
